Opti-myst, an innovative technology used by Evonic, can create an authentic flame effect without the use of venting or fuel. Instead an ultrasonic mist is used to create the illusion that logs or coals are burning. This is reflected by LED lights in the enhanced depth of the fuel bed, which gives a stunningly lifelike appearance.

Easy to maintain
Electric fire suites are much less expensive to maintain than other heating methods. Electric fire suites don't require gas lines or chimneys. This means you can warm your home without having to pay a lot for energy bills. In addition, you won't have to deal with dirty carbon monoxide or ashes that result from burning wood. Instead, you can clean the glass and then wipe off any dust that has built up over time.
Before you begin cleaning, ensure that your fireplace is off and unplugged. It is essential to inspect for wires that are exposed because they could pose a significant hazard to children and pets. Make sure to read the owner's manual and follow any safety rules specific to your particular model.
If your fireplace is wall-mounted you can use a soft brush or cloth to remove any dust that has accumulated. To stop dust from accumulating and causing damage to your fireplace, you must clean both the inlet and outlet vents in the front and the back of the fireplace. After cleaning the vents you can clean the glass of your fireplace. Use a microfibre cloth to gently clean the interior and exterior of your fireplace.
After you've cleaned the appliance, you should inspect it for signs of wear and wear and tear. If you notice any loose connections or damaged wiring, you should to get a professional to inspect and fix the issue before you plug the fire in again. Replace the bulbs in your fire suite at minimum every two years. This will keep the flame effects authentic and fresh.
